Задать вопрос

Как парсить sqlite?

Есть желание, написать модуль, преобразования sqlite3 базы в txt \ xml. Вариант использования стандартной sqlite3 DLL не рассматриваю, смотреть в C исходники не могу, много всего там а мне нужно только hex строение, да и C это не мое. Первые 100 байт заголовка это просто, все понятно, дальше застрял. Не могу получить смещение в байтах к записям в таблице, плюс необходимо определить тип записи. Где можно подробно посмотреть, как там все устроено?
На официальном сайте sqlite3 есть документация, больно закручено все там.
  • Вопрос задан
  • 2453 просмотра
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Инженер по тестированию
    5 месяцев
    Далее
  • Яндекс Практикум
    Java-разработчик
    10 месяцев
    Далее
  • Яндекс Практикум
    Python-разработчик расширенный
    14 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 2
NeiroNx
@NeiroNx
Программист
Если все так закручено - то используйте соответвующий драйвер. Я бы использовал Python - в линухах он часто по умолчанию ставится и драйвер sqlite3 есть в стандарных комплектах.
Ответ написан
saintbyte
@saintbyte
Django developer
У меня есть для вас вредный совет - попробуйте bash =)
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ы
ITK academy Нижний Новгород
от 50 000 до 90 000 ₽
ITK academy Воронеж
от 50 000 до 90 000 ₽